
A former council chief executive has been appointed to review complaints for press regulator the Independent Press Standards Organisation.
Trish Haines, who worked at Reading Borough Council and Worcestershire County Council, has taken up the position of independent complaints reviewer.
The role is an important part of IPSO’s service to complainants. Haines will review the regulator’s handling of investigated complaints to ensure the process has been fair and transparent.
